The renewal of our three-year agreement with Torvane Materials has been assessed in detail. Proposed terms include a 4.2% unit-price increase, partially offset by improved volume rebates and extended payment terms of sixty days. Sensitivity analysis indicates a net annual cost impact of under 1% on the Meridia product line, assuming stable demand. Legal has flagged no material changes to liability clauses. We recommend approval, subject to the conditions outlined in the confidential note below.

confidential, yawip-bahif: Zorokox Partners plans to lower the Casax list price by 28.0 percent in April. The board signed off on a budget of $271.0 million for Project Juldor. The renewal with Pelokox Partners closes at $410.1 million a year, 3.4 percent below the last contract. Project Pelok slips by a full year because of the audit delay.

## Introduce per-tenant rate quotas in the Orvane gateway

For the release manager: this change replaces our global throttle with per-tenant quotas, resolved at request time from the tenant registry and cached for sixty seconds. Tenants without an explicit quota inherit the tier default; overage returns a retryable status with a hint header. Rollout is gated behind a flag, defaulting off, and the old throttle remains as a backstop until two clean release cycles pass.

The initial tier defaults we intend to ship are listed below.

limits module of taguf-hafog:
WEIGHTS = {
    "wenox": 690,
    "wenok": 782,
    "kelax": 41,
    "holox": 338,
    "quenir": 39,
}

## Alert: StatRelay Sidecar Flush Lag

This alert fires when the StatRelay metrics-aggregation sidecar falls more than 120 seconds behind on flushing buffered samples to the Coalmine backend. Plugin-emitted counters are buffered in-process, so sustained lag usually means a plugin is emitting unbounded label cardinality or blocking the flush thread. Check your plugin's metric registration against the published cardinality limits before escalating. If the lag persists after your plugin is ruled out, contact the telemetry team.

escalation mailbox, bagug-fahof: novdor.wendor.jormir@norvalabs.example